Mr. Rоdriguez trаveled tо Idаhо for the summer, where he plаced a for-sale-by-owner sign in front of his property. Mr. Rodriguez then spent time getting his cabin and property ready to show. While trimming trees and chopping wood one day, he experienced an injury where a piece of wood hit him in the leg and punctured his skin and muscle. After resisting medical treatment for a few days, he went to the hospital for treatment, and rested indoors for a week. During the time when he was resting indoors, three potential buyers had approached his cabin and rang the doorbell looking for information. Mr. Rodriguez learned about this several weeks later and had never heard the doorbell, nor any people or vehicles nearby. At the end of the summer, Mr. Rodriguez returned to Phoenix and was grateful to be fully recovered from his leg injury, and also home to his family after a particularly lonely and taxing summer. There was a stack of mail waiting for him, full of flyers and mailings advertising hearing aids and hearing aid services. Today, he decided to look through them rather than throwing them away. He also completed an online hearing screening, which suggested that he might have hearing loss, so he called a local office listed on one of the advertisements he received in the mail and made an appointment.  Now, where is Mr. Rodriguez on his journey?
